Who was the CEO of Disney in 1991?

Michael Dammann Eisner is an American businessman, who was the chief executive officer of Walt Disney Productions (later restructed into The Walt Disney Company) from September 22, 1984 to September 30, 2005.

Who was president of Disney before Bob Iger?

Robert Iger was named the CEO of The Walt Disney Company in 2005. His appointment, however, was not assured prior to its occurring. Iger took over from Michael Eisner, whose 21-year tenure at the top of the company was at first stellar and later tumultuous.

Does the Disney family still own Disney?

As for how much the Disney family is worth these days, that's not entirely clear. According to Walt Disney's grand-nephew, Roy Patrick Disney, Walt and Roy owned about 20% of the company by 1960 and today the whole family owns less than 3% of it. Most of the family has stayed out of the business.

Who was the CEO of Disney in 2000?

From 2000-2005, Mr. Iger served as Disney's President and Chief Operating Officer. He officially joined the Disney senior management team in 1996 as Chairman of the Disney-owned ABC Group, and in 1999, was given the additional responsibility of President, Walt Disney International.

What is Disney CEO's salary?

In an SEC filing Tuesday, the company reported Iger's total compensation for 2023 amounted to nearly $31.6 million, including his $865,385 salary, $16.1 million in stock and $10 million worth of options.

Who was the CEO of Disney in 1983?

Ronald William Miller (April 17, 1933 – February 9, 2019) was an American businessman and professional American football player. He was president and CEO of The Walt Disney Company from 1980 to 1984 and was president of the board of directors of the Walt Disney Family Museum.
